Melinda is a hard working college student
She wants to finish at the top of her class at Harvard Law School. She writes for the Harvard Law Review. In her spare time, she donates time to the Innocence Project. She is hard-working, driven, and ambitious. Melinda has a _____ personality.
Fill in the blank with correct word
Answer: Type A
